    Bayville Farm, also known as Church Point Plantation and Bayside Plantation, was a historic plantation house in Virginia Beach, Virginia.. The house was built in 1827 and enlarged in the 1840s, and was a two-story, five-bay, two-story, double-pile, frame structure with brick ends.

    Thoroughgood House by Frances Benjamin Johnston. It was designated a National Historic Landmark in 1960, as a prime example of early colonial architecture in Virginia. [7] It was listed in the US National Register of Historic Places in 1966. [2] Another nearby surviving early 18th-century house in Virginia Beach is the Adam Keeling House.

    It is located south of the Virginia Beach Courthouse complex, still surrounded by farm land but facing increasing encroachment by suburban homes. [ 3 ] The house is a wood frame two-story structure with a brick American bond chimney with Flemish bond headers and asphalt shingles.
